What to wear when walking in winters


When walking in cold weather, you need to dress in layers that will wick away moisture, insulate from the cold, and keep out the wind and rain. From head to toe and inside to outside, here is what to wear.
Use the Layering Principle

Base Layer: Wicking fabric to keep your skin dry and prevent that clammy feeling.


Insulating Layer: Fleece or wool, vest or shirt that can be added or removed depending on how cold you feel.


Windproof and Water-Resistant Outer Layer: A jacket, preferably with a hood, to keep out the elements

How to look slimmer in front of camera


Why is it that celebrities always look skinny in red carpet photos?The secret is in the pose.
Secret No. 1: Turn partially sideways to the camera, planting one foot in front of the other. Point your toe to the camera and place your weight on your back foot.


Secret No. 2: Pull head forward slightly to minimize any appearance of a double chin.

Secret No. 3: Hold arms slightly away from your body. This keeps upper arm flab from flattening out and therefore appearing flabbier (much like thighs do when one sits on a couch).

Secret No. 4: Pull shoulders back, chest forward and gently suck stomach in. Be careful not to suck stomach so far in that your ribs show, thereby causing those who later see the photo to cluck to themselves in a bemused, sing-song voice, "She's sucking i-in."

Secret No. 5: If you can get away with it without looking like a Sports Illustrated Swimsuit Cover Girl wannabe, try the look away trick. To do this, look away from the camera, then turn towards it, breaking into a smile just before the camera clicks. Your smile will appear fresh, not frozen. This trick takes practice behind closed, locked doors.

BASIC FACE CARE


Many people take their skin for granted. The skin has several basic needs. First, it needs to be kept as clean as possible. Second, the skin needs to be protected from sunlight and other environmental insults. The skin of the face needs even more attention than the rest of the body because the face has more oil glands, especially the central forehead, eye areas, nose and chin. One needs to perform a brief morning regimen for the facial skin and a longer regimen before going to bed. Once you have your skin care regimen down, it will only take five to ten minutes a day.


Morning Facial Care:
In the morning you should clean your face with luke-warm water and a creamy cleanser or purifying gel wash. Avoid bar soap because this strips the natural moisturizing factors from the skin, leaving it feeling very tight and dry. Do not rub the skin dry. Instead, blot it gently with a towel. Your morning facial care can be done in the shower or at the sink.


Next, you should tone the skin on the face. Toning the skin helps remove any residual cleanser or make-up that may have been left behind. A toner also helps restore the natural pH level of the skin, leaves your skin clean, clear and ready to be hydrated.


Next, apply a moisturizer or day cream which should be specialized to your skin type. A moisturizer leaves the skin feeling softer and smoother. It also helps smooth away fine lines and dryness. A sunscreen can be applied on top of the moisturizer.


Next, apply your make-up (if you choose to wear make-up). Your foundation should match your skin tone. Never use a darker foundation than your skin tone; it should look natural.

How to properly apply mascara


Ace your mascara application with a three-step process:



Step 1: Wiggle the wand left to right at the base of lashes. It's the mascara placed near the roots -- not the tips -- that gives the illusion of length.
Step 2: Pull the wand up and through lashes, wiggling as you go. The wiggling part is key: Wiggling separates lashes.
Step 3: In this final step (which we always skip), close the eye and place the mascara wand on top of lashes at the base and pull through to remove any clumps.
